In this work, self-made MXene (Ti3C2Tx … electroall webWebCorrect option is B) Ethyl alcohol is more soluble than dimethyl ether due to the presence of intermolecular hydrogen bonding. Hydrogen bonding is possible when H atom is attached to an electronegative atom such as N, O or F.
